The Graduate Management Admission Test (GMAT) is a computer adaptive test (CAT) intended to assess certain analytical, writing, quantitative, verbal, and reading skills in written English for use in admission to a graduate management program, such as an MBA. GMAT Pattern: Analytical Writing Assessment (AWA) Integrated reasoning Quantitative section Verbal section Here are the 30 American business schools with the highest average GMAT requirement for MBA degree: The list includes: 1. Stanford – 730 2. Harvard – 724 3. Chicago (Booth) – 719 4. NYU (Stern) – 719 5. Yale – 719 6. Pennsylvania (Wharton) – 718 7. Dartmouth (Tuck) – 718 8. Columbia – 716 9. UC Berkeley (Haas) – 715 10. Northwestern (Kellogg) – 712 11. MIT (Sloan) – 710 12. UCLA (Anderson) – 704 13. Michigan (Ross) – 703 14. Virginia (Darden) – 701 15. Wash U. (Olin) – 696 16. Vanderbilt (Owen) – 695 17. U. of Texas – Austin (McCombs) – 692 18. Notre Dame (Mendoza) – 692 19. Cornell (Johnson) – 691 20. UC Davis – 690 21. Duke (Fuqua) – 689 22. UNC (Kenan-Flagler) – 689 23. USC (Marshall) – 687 24. Carnegie Mellon (Tepper) – 686 25. Georgetown (McDonough) – 686 26. Minnesota (Carlson) – 686 27. Boston University – 684 28. Emory (Goizueta) – 681 29. U. of Wisconsin – Madison – 680 30. U. of Florida (Hough) – 678 |
